In the early 1800s, there was a smallpox outbreak in a remote part of Russia.The government sent in a large group of army doctors, but they were too late to stop the epidemic.Thirty years later, there was another smallpox scare.A local statistician cautioned the government against a similar response, noting the increased mortality and high number of army doctors during the earlier epidemic.Was the statistician providing good advice?

Installment Contract

Under the Uniform Commercial Code, a contract that requires or authorizes delivery in two or more separate lots to be accepted and paid for separately.

Truth-In-Lending Act

A federal law designed to promote informed use of consumer credit by requiring disclosures about its terms and cost.
